The Best Time to Take an ATV Tour in Cappadocia
Morning vs Sunset Tours
Morning tours are peaceful and fresh, but sunset tours? That’s when the magic really happens. The sky turns into a painter’s palette of oranges, pinks, and purples. You’ll feel like you’re inside a dream.
Seasonal Considerations
Spring and autumn are ideal—cooler temps and fewer tourists. Summer can get hot, and winter brings snow, which can also be magical if you’re up for the chill.
Must-Visit Spots on Your ATV Journey
Love Valley
No filters needed here. The unique rock formations give this valley its cheeky name, and the views are spectacular.
Red Valley
The red-hued rocks at sunset are straight out of a movie scene. It’s a favorite stop for photographers.
Rose Valley
With its soft pastel tones and winding paths, Rose Valley is serene and perfect for introspective rides.
Sword Valley
Named after its sharp, sword-like formations, this valley is raw, rugged, and a must-see on any ATV route.

Safety Tips for ATV Tours
What Gear Do You Need?
Helmets are a must. Sunglasses, gloves, and something to cover your mouth from the dust are highly recommended.
Tour Guide or Solo?
First time in Cappadocia? Go with a Cappadocia ATV Tourguide. They know the terrain and the best hidden spots. Experienced rider? You can rent and roam free—but be smart and cautious.

Planning Your Cappadocia ATV Tour
How to Book
Tours can be booked online, at your hotel, or through travel agents in town. Most last 2-4 hours and include a guide and gear.
Tour Duration and Costs
Prices vary depending on time and route, but expect to pay between $30-$70 per person. Some tours offer group discounts.

FAQs
1. Do I need prior experience to drive an Cappadocia ATV Tour?
Nope! Most tours are beginner-friendly and include a short training session before the ride.
2. Is an ATV tour safe for kids?
Some tours allow children to ride with adults, but check with the provider first. It’s usually not suitable for very young kids.
3. Can I do an ATV tour in winter?
Yes, but be prepared for cold and possibly snowy conditions. It can be a magical snowy adventure!
4. How long is a typical ATV tour in Cappadocia?
Most last 2 to 4 hours. Some longer packages include meals or extended routes.
5. Do I need a driver’s license for an ATV tour?
In most cases, yes—a basic car license is enough. But always double-check with your tour provider.
